ISAIAH 40:31 But they that wait upon the Lord shall renew their strength; they shall mount up with wings as eagles; they shall run, and not be weary; and they shall walk, and not faint.

Too many people believe that praying only means requesting their wants from God. Prayer, however, is much more than that.

Prayer is a channel of interaction and connection with the Almighty. Somehow, when we pray, God's power is given to us in an exchange.

LUKE 22:46 And said unto them, Why sleep ye? rise and pray, lest ye enter into temptation.

Being resilient helps you resist enticement.

Spending time in prayer helps you grow spiritually.

JUDE 1:20 And, behold, thou shalt be dumb, and not able to speak, until the day that these things shall be performed, because thou believest not my words, which shall be fulfilled in their season.

Jude claims that prayer develops you up or edifies you.

The more you pray, the more spiritually strong you become because prayer is a spiritual exercise.

Some people might object that they are unable to pray. Just start chatting with God.

And keep an eye out for His reply—not in the form of a voice, but rather through His Word or thoughts that are consistent with it.
